JOB SUMMARY

Employees of the Legislative Assembly of British Columbia (Assembly) provide professional non-partisan services to support the democratic institution of Parliament and its members through procedural advice, administrative support and information services. The Assembly is an autonomous employer, separate from the administrative framework of B.C. government ministries and agencies.
The Sergeant-at-Arms department is seeking up to six attentive, diplomatic and service-oriented individuals for the auxiliary as-and-when position of Sessional Officer.
Reporting to the Gallery, Chamber, Corridor, or Security Scanning Supervisor, the Sessional Officers facilitate and control access of MLAs and others who have legitimate access to the Chamber, galleries, corridors, and/or committee rooms, and provide security-related duties during House sittings, committee meetings and support the security screening process for all members of the public who enter the Parliament Building. They prepare the Chamber, galleries, corridors and associated rooms and facilities for use and secure them afterwards. The position must be cognizant of the high profile of the Legislature and ensure all undertaken issues are handled with tact and discretion and follow protocol.
Sessional Officers work a fluctuating work schedule. Work hours are as-needed and can fall between 8:30am and 7:00pm, Mondays through Thursdays when the House is in session. Other work is available during visitor hours on an as needed basis when the House is not in session. Visitor hours are 8:30 am to 4:30 pm Monday through Friday and are seven days per week during the summer months.
